What is Ivermectin Cream?
Ivermectin cream is a topical medication containing the antiparasitic drug ivermectin. It is primarily formulated for human use to treat various skin conditions caused by parasites. Specifically, it is a prescription treatment for rosacea, a chronic inflammatory skin condition characterized by facial redness and bumps. The cream works by reducing inflammation and targeting mites on the skin that are believed to contribute to rosacea symptoms. Its application is typically once daily, for a defined period, to achieve therapeutic effects for conditions like inflammatory lesions of rosacea.

What Regulatory and Policy Factors Shape the Global Ivermectin Cream Market
The global Ivermectin Cream market navigates a complex regulatory environment. Approvals for topical use, primarily for conditions like rosacea and some parasitic infestations, are established in many key regions including North America, Europe, and parts of Asia Pacific, generally requiring a prescription. Health authorities worldwide maintain stringent oversight on pharmaceutical manufacturing and quality control standards. A significant policy challenge arises from widespread misinformation regarding ivermectin's off label systemic use, which has prompted various governmental and health organizations to issue warnings. These advisories, while targeting oral formulations, create a heightened scrutiny that indirectly influences the regulatory perception and market dynamics for legitimate topical applications. Compliance with national drug administration guidelines is paramount.
